AISFM and
Hyderabad Film Club Bring Bangladeshi Film Festival to
Hyderabad
~ Five most popular Bangladeshi films to be showcased ~
Hyderabad|India|August'2012:
South India’s
premier film school - Annapurna International School of Film +Media (AISFM)
and the Hyderabad Film Club are conducting a Bangladeshi Film festival on
August 10th, 11th & 12th 2012.
Despite the growing world-wide
recognition of Bangladeshi cinema, few of these films have
achieved exposure within India. This festival, a joint effort
between AISFM and Hyderabad Film Club, is a step towards
bringing some of Bangladesh’s most successful films to the
film-lovers of Hyderabad.
A lot of young people today are
interested in cinema as a profession and career option. Exposure
to International cinema would help them gain a better
perspective on film making. AISFM’s effort is to cater to such
interested students and enrich them with the nuances of global
cinema.
The festival will be held
on August 10th, 11th & 12th at
AISFM Premises, Annapurna Studios, Banjara Hills.
All films are free to attend.

The Annapurna
International School of Film and Media has been formed as a
non-profit entity of Annapurna Studios with the dual missions of
providing an incredible education for students and offering
highly trained talent to the entire media industry. The school
is a model of openness and transparency, with publicly available
data posted online for all to see, and staff and faculty
meetings open to the public. Students will be required to
complete community service, helping charitable organizations to
understand and utilize media.The Annapurna International School
of Film and Media is backed by some of south India’s biggest
names in filmmaking, acting, animation and visual effects.
